Miele. I’ve got a 9-month-old G7600 Dishwasher that suddenly stopped working and I’ve had 4 service calls booked and cancelled so far due to a part being unavailable, or the parts being delivered broken depending upon who you speak to. Next time I’ll probably buy a Bosch Series 8.

In the same time period I’ve had an old Indesit tumble dryer repaired (water tank full sensor fault) then replaced when the engineer damaged the door hinges and the chassis is no longer in production. The Hotpoint heat pump tumble dryer they replaced it with is working great so far with a quarter of the energy usage of the old one. I can’t believe Indesit of all companies managed to beat Miele in customer service.
